Correlation of configuration of some organosilanes

Abstract

A series of chemical interconversions are described which supplement evidence obtained previously for assignment of configuration to (–)-mesitylmethoxymethylphenylsilane, (–)-benzyl(methoxy)(methyl)phenylsilane, and (–)-isopropyl(methoxy)(methyl)phenylsilane. The reaction of bromine with (+)-mesitylmethylphenyl-1-naphthylsilane has been shown to lead to formation of bromo(methyl)-1-naphthylphenyisilane and mesityl bromide in good yield and with a high degree of stereospecificity.
